[QUOTE="Rooster, post: 1178239, member: 19605"] Read your manual. Read your manual, save yourself from the frustrations. It's all in there, step by step. There is a list that tells you what the stock jetting is on your year/model. I have a '00 YZ250 and pretty much any question I have is answered by reading the manual, aside from how to be a better rider ;) Drop your needle a clip, and throw one size smaller pilot jet in there. You may have to lean out your main jet too, it takes time, be patient. Make sure you go to the standard spark plugs as I mentioned before. The elecrode on those high dollar plugs foul up in a hurry. My best bet is you are fouling plugs because you aren't keeping up in the RPM's. I used to get that all the time, because I trail ride my YZ. Once I dropped the needle and played around with the jets, all became well. Best of luck Roost [/QUOTE]
